Description

  • Content Description: Photograph of 1 person. This image is of two photographs of a woman. She is wearing a shirt and a large coat with fur around the trim and around the collar of her shirt. She is also wearing a pearl necklace and another necklace, a brooch and earrings. In the first photograph, she is turned slightly facing the right and in the second photograph, she is turned slightly to the left. She is looking directly at the camera in both photographs.
